Job Summary
Operate and program CNC equipment; supervise production, engineering and quality staff to produce quality parts while meeting customer needs. Develop and review machine layouts and setup, provide quotes to Sales, troubleshoot machining problems, plan production processes with Quality and Engineering, document changes, and ensure safety and productivity. Instruct and develop staff, coordinate across departments, perform maintenance and paperwork, enforce safety policies, schedule material availability and machine utilization, and evaluate training needs for staff. Strong leadership, problem-solving, and communication skills with knowledge of CNC lathe, tooling, layout, MRP/Global Shop, and Kaizen practices.
Required Qualifications
- Bachelor’s degree in Business administration, manufacturing technology, or related field
- 3-5 years’ experience on CNC machines or similar industry, or equivalent combination of education and experience
